DENVER, Feb. 12 /PRNewswire/ — Colorado’s sunny days, legendary spring skiing, festivals and special events make it an ideal spring break vacation destination. This year, Colorado’s resorts are offering deals like never before. Below are just a few ways to enjoy spring in Colorado. For a complete list of packages, visit www.colorado.com/deals

Hot Happenings

  • Skijoring & The Crystal Carnival – March 7-8, 2009. Watch skiers, pulled by riders on horseback, compete over a series of snow-packed jumps through downtown Leadville. www.leadville.com
  • Head to Aspen/Snowmass for the 9th Annual Bud Light Spring Jam. The Bud Light Spring Jam is two weekends of new-school competitions and downtown concerts held March 20-22 and 27-29, 2009. For a complete listing of activities, visit www.aspensnowmass.com
  • River Run’s Blues & Barbecue Festival in Keystone, March 28, 2009. Enjoy dynamic live music and lip-smacking brews. www.keystone.snow.com
  • Spring Massive in Breckenridge, April 1-19, 2009. An interactive event including music, family fun and on-hill competitions. Events include the Bite of Breckenridge, Massive Comedy Nights, Massive Brewfest, Massive Competition Weekend and the ever-popular season finale – Massive Music Weekend. www.breckenridge.snow.com
